css选择器优先级最高的是什么-思玲小站

  • css选择器优先级最高的是什么-思玲小站已关闭评论
  • A+
所属分类:技术教程
摘要

CSS 选择器优先级最高的是内联样式,它直接写在 HTML 元素的 style 属性中,具有最高的优先级,其他优先级依次为:ID 选择器、类选择器、元素选择器、通配符选择器。

css 选择器优先级最高的是内联样式,它直接写在 html 元素的 style 属性中,具有最高的优先级,其他优先级依次为:id 选择器、类选择器、元素选择器、通配符选择器。

css选择器优先级最高的是什么-思玲小站

CSS选择器优先级最高的是什么?

在CSS中,选择器优先级决定了哪些样式规则将被应用到元素上。优先级最高的规则将覆盖优先级较低的规则。

CSS选择器优先级的最高级别是:

内联样式

内联样式直接写在HTML元素的style属性中。由于它们最直接地应用于元素,因此具有最高的优先级。

例如:

<code class="html"><p style="color: red;">这是红色文本。</p></code>
登录后复制

ID选择器

ID选择器使用元素的ID属性来选择元素。ID属性唯一标识每个元素,因此ID选择器具有非常高的优先级。

例如:

<code class="css">#my-element {
  color: blue;
}</code>
登录后复制

类选择器

类选择器使用元素的class属性来选择元素。类属性可以应用于多个元素,因此类选择器的优先级低于ID选择器。

例如:

<code class="css">.my-class {
  color: green;
}</code>
登录后复制

元素选择器

元素选择器选择特定类型的元素,例如p、h1或div。元素选择器的优先级低于类选择器。

例如:

<code class="css">p {
  color: black;
}</code>
登录后复制

通配符选择器

通配符选择器(*)选择文档中的所有元素。其优先级最低。

例如:

<code class="css">* {
  font-size: 12px;
}</code>
登录后复制

如果多个选择器具有相同的优先级,则将使用最后声明的规则。遵循上述优先级顺序,可以确保特定元素的样式应用正确的规则。

以上就是css选择器优先级最高的是什么的详细内容,更多请关注我们其它相关文章!